Ever feel like you've become the person everyone depends on while quietly falling apart behind the scenes? In this episode, Tracy Doyle shares her deeply personal journey through burnout, from self-sacrifice and resentment to rebuilding her life through boundaries, honest communication, and daily reset practices. Laura Jane and Tracy unpack why so many high achievers lose themselves in doing, how triggers reveal unmet needs, and what it really takes to stop living in survival mode.
